Unmatched Versatility and Durability
Neoprene O-Rings are renowned for their exceptional versatility and durability. Made from synthetic rubber, these O-Rings offer a balanced combination of flexibility, resilience, and resistance to a wide range of environmental factors. Neoprene is highly resistant to oils, chemicals, heat, ozone, and weathering, making it an ideal material for applications that require reliable sealing in harsh conditions. This versatility makes Neoprene O-Rings suitable for use in numerous industries, including automotive, aerospace, marine, and manufacturing.
Key Applications Across Industries
The automotive industry is one of the primary sectors where Neoprene O-Rings are extensively used. These O-Rings play a crucial role in sealing engines, fuel systems, and hydraulic systems, preventing leaks and ensuring optimal performance. In the aerospace sector, Neoprene O-Rings are used in aircraft engines, landing gear systems, and other critical components where reliable sealing is essential for safety and efficiency. The marine industry benefits from Neoprene O-Rings' resistance to saltwater and harsh marine environments, making them ideal for sealing underwater equipment, boat engines, and marine HVAC systems.
In manufacturing, Neoprene O-Rings are used in a wide range of machinery and equipment, providing reliable seals in pumps, compressors, valves, and fluid power systems. Their ability to withstand varying pressures and temperatures makes them a preferred choice for industrial applications that require consistent performance and longevity.

Cost-Effectiveness and Ease of Maintenance
One of the key advantages of Neoprene O-Rings is their cost-effectiveness. Neoprene is a relatively inexpensive material compared to other high-performance elastomers, making Neoprene O-Rings an economical choice for sealing solutions. Additionally, their durability and resistance to wear and tear reduce the frequency of replacements, leading to lower maintenance costs and increased operational efficiency. The ease of installation and compatibility with standard sealing grooves further contribute to their widespread adoption across industries.
